It’s now *goes to check my calendarofficially fall, which gives me an excuse to update my wardrobe stat—especially since it’s universally agreed upon that we’re having a French Girl fall this year. Sézane has quickly become one of my go-to shopping destinations for its endless rotation of timeless classics and core staples. For fall, the brand has *tons* of pieces at various price points that will have you more than equipped for the cool temps ahead. That includes plenty of trendy new arrivals that play up this season's big boho vibe, such as this stunning floral Sézane x Bazist Alice cardigan ($195), which I can already imagine pairing with my barrel jeans, and this romantic lace blouse ($195) that seems straight out of the '70s. Très hippie chic.

I absolutely adore this floral cardigan, which is made from a blend of cozy mohair and merino wool, and features unique embroidery that gives it a quaint, handmade touch. It has a slightly cropped fit and open construction, save for the darling little tie closure at the neckline that can be finished with the perfect bow. 

A perfect choice for a work event, lunch out with the girls or fall festival, this suede shift dress is incredibly flattering on all body types with its round neckline and A-line shape. While the fit is meant to be on the looser side, it still frames your body nicely while remaining totally comfortable. And as a lover of all things 1960s, I'd also like to call out its flower child flair, which is more than enough reason for me to add it to my cart right now

If you're looking for a layer that won't just keep you toasty in cooler temps, but will also add a little bit of artsy oomph to your outfits, you can stop your search thanks to this beauty. The quilted shirt-jacket is decked out in delicate floral embroidery, and is made of 100 percent organic cotton that promises to be as sturdy as it is soft. And with a button-up closure and two spacious patch pockets in front, this piece isn't just pretty, but practical, too. 

According to PureWow Fashion Editor Abby Hepworth, Western styles are still going strong as one of the top boot trends for fall 2025, so this luxe split-leather pair comes right on time. In addition to displaying the coolest cowgirl designs on the shaft, the knee-high boots boast a low block heel and rubber outsole, so you can bet they were made for walkin' (and line dancing, if you're into it). 

This dreamy lace blouse is just begging to be added to your closet. With its airy embroidery, billowy sleeves and mostly organic cotton construction, it'll be plenty breezy on those warmer fall days, though you can also layer it with a tank underneath for extra coverage. And while you don't have to take my word for it, I reckon it will look just as good with a pair of flare jeans that play up its boho look as it will with an eyelet maxi skirt.

Heavy on the rustic charm, this alpaca and wool-blend cardigan would go straight into the suitcase of any Parisian hitting a chalet in the French Alps. So if you want to feel like an après-ski fashionista (wherever you may actually be), I'd grab this number to bundle up in 'til spring.


Suede trousers that look like jeans? That's right. You'll absolutely obsess over the slim-but-relaxed fit, not to mention the super cute embroidery adorning the two front pockets. And while these pants might be a steeper investment, the quality ensures they will last for years.

French country charm meets home-on-the-range Americana in this embroidered button-down, made from a lightweight cotton/linen blend that makes it ideal for throwing on as an open shacket or donning solo all buttoned up. Since this is an oversized shirt, you may want to consider sizing down if you want a more tailored fit. 

Crisp fall days are ahead, and suddenly, I'm dreaming of a corduroy jacket to help me transition through the season. Luckily, Sézane has the cutest style that will stand out from the post-dropoff coffee run to the weekend leaf-peeping excursion. It has two front patch pockets that are roomy enough to hold your phone and wallet if you have to go bagless, and the lightweight construction is great for layering under thicker coats when you need to fend off wind and light rain. And those colorful floral details? Adorable.

Thigh-high boots are always a great choice for fall (just ask Taylor Swift), and this suede pair puts a funky bohemian twist on the style. They feature a slighty chunky 3-inch heel that adds quite a bit of height while remaining easy to walk in, giving you the best of both worlds in terms of style and comfort. I also adore the contrasting ecru embroidery against the chocolate brown color, which not only adds to its versatility, but gives the silhouette some added visual appeal.
